Eike Spruth is a scholar working on Molecular Biology, Neurology and Immunology. According to data from OpenAlex, Eike Spruth has authored 5 papers receiving a total of 344 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Molecular Biology, 3 papers in Neurology and 2 papers in Immunology. Recurrent topics in Eike Spruth's work include Immune cells in cancer (2 papers), Neuroinflammation and Neurodegeneration Mechanisms (2 papers) and Genetic Neurodegenerative Diseases (1 paper). Eike Spruth is often cited by papers focused on Immune cells in cancer (2 papers), Neuroinflammation and Neurodegeneration Mechanisms (2 papers) and Genetic Neurodegenerative Diseases (1 paper). Eike Spruth collaborates with scholars based in Germany, United Kingdom and Netherlands. Eike Spruth's co-authors include Josef Priller, Marjolein A. M. Sneeboer, Désirée Kunkel, Pawel Fidzinski, Britta Siegmund, Elly M. Hol, Gijsje J. L. Snijders, René S. Kahn, Henrik E. Mei and Rainer Glauben and has published in prestigious journals such as Nature Communications, Nature Neuroscience and Methods.

All Works

5 of 5 papers shown
1.
Fernández‐Zapata, Camila, Eike Spruth, Jinte Middeldorp, et al.. (2022). Differential compartmentalization of myeloid cell phenotypes and responses towards the CNS in Alzheimer’s disease. Nature Communications. 13(1). 7210–7210. 13 indexed citations
2.
Andrade‐Navarro, Miguel A., Eike Spruth, Nancy Mah, et al.. (2020). RNA Sequencing of Human Peripheral Blood Cells Indicates Upregulation of Immune-Related Genes in Huntington's Disease. Frontiers in Neurology. 11. 573560–573560. 11 indexed citations
3.
Böttcher, Chotima, Stephan Schlickeiser, Marjolein A. M. Sneeboer, et al.. (2018). Human microglia regional heterogeneity and phenotypes determined by multiplexed single-cell mass cytometry. Nature Neuroscience. 22(1). 78–90. 296 indexed citations
4.
Fontaine, Jean−Fred, Josef Priller, Eike Spruth, Carol Perez‐Iratxeta, & Miguel A. Andrade‐Navarro. (2014). Assessment of curated phenotype mining in neuropsychiatric disorder literature. Methods. 74. 90–96. 3 indexed citations
5.
Doepp, Florian, et al.. (2005). Ultrasonographic measurement of cerebral blood flow, cerebral circulation time and cerebral blood volume in vascular and Alzheimer’s dementia. Journal of Neurology. 252(10). 1171–1177. 21 indexed citations
